Digital X-Ray Technology
Traditional dental practices previously relied on conventional x-ray systems that required time-consuming film development processes. Today, we employ advanced digital x-ray technology that offers numerous patient benefits over outdated film-based systems. Digital x-rays provide enhanced safety protocols while delivering significantly faster imaging results. When image clarity needs improvement, we can immediately capture a new digital x-ray without delay. This essential diagnostic technology enables our team to gain comprehensive insights into your oral anatomy, including detailed visualization of teeth structures, root systems, and surrounding alveolar bone tissue.
Diagnodent Laser Detection System
Our Diagnodent laser technology enables more precise identification of dental decay within the occlusal (biting) surfaces of teeth. This advanced laser system measures fluorescence levels within tooth mineral structures, allowing our team to distinguish between healthy tooth tissue and early-stage smooth surface dental caries (tooth decay). Early detection capabilities help us provide timely, conservative treatment interventions before decay progresses to require extensive and costly restorative procedures.
3D Imaging Technology
Advanced 3D imaging provides Dr. Sikka with comprehensive three-dimensional visualization of your teeth and surrounding gum tissues. This sophisticated diagnostic tool enhances our ability to accurately diagnose potential oral health issues and develop effective, personalized treatment plans. We utilize 3D imaging technology for various applications including cosmetic dentistry procedures, restorative treatments, orthodontic planning, and precise dental implant placement.
